He studied her from across the kitchen. Watched her as she tiptoed around looking for the right size pot for whatever she planned on making them all for breakfast that morning. He thought she looked thin, the clothes on her back seemed larger than normal. He squinted. She also had bags under her eyes, a sign that she'd been overworking herself, again.

Ah, she's found the pot. He mentally counted the number of people at their home this morning: He, her, and Hakase, would be eating, of course, but they had three visitors crashing as well, too drunk to go home last night. Six people...and one of them is Genta…

He made his way across the room and reached his arms around Shiho, taking the pot away from her. Placing it down on the counter, he wrapped himself around her, measuring. No, that pot definitely won't do.

"You sit," he says in lieu of an answer to her questioning gaze. "I'll make breakfast today." She needs some meat on those bones.


Omake: Shiho lets him, forgetting that there isn't an ounce of kitchen talent in his body. She ends up taking everyone out for brunch.
